    U.S. Marine Corps Capt. Alex Schermacher, a native of Ohio and a forward air controller/air officer with 5th Air Naval Gunfire Liaison Company, III Marine Expeditionary Force Information Group, and Republic of Korea service members contest possession of the ball during a soccer match on Yeonpyeong Island, Republic of Korea, March 18, 2026. The activity enhanced unit cohesion and strengthened partnerships between allied forces during exercise Freedom Shield 26. Freedom Shield 26 is a combined, joint, all-domain exercise designed to enhance the defensive capabilities and interoperability of the ROK-U.S. Alliance, reinforcing the alliance’s role in regional peace and security.
